Senior software engineer golang jobs & Careers



What is a Senior Software Engineer Golang job?

A Senior Software Engineer Golang job is a position that requires expertise in the Go programming language. This job is focused on developing and maintaining software programs that are written in Golang. The role requires an understanding of software design principles and the ability to develop software that meets the needs of the business.

What do you usually do in this position?

As a Senior Software Engineer Golang, your primary responsibility will be to write, test, and maintain software programs using Golang. You will work closely with other developers and stakeholders to ensure that the software meets the requirements of the business. You will also be responsible for ensuring that the software is scalable, maintainable, and efficient.

Top 5 skills for this position

  • Expertise in Golang programming language
  • Strong understanding of software design principles
  • Experience in developing scalable, maintainable, and efficient software
  • Ability to work collaboratively with other developers and stakeholders
  • Strong problem-solving skills

How to become a Senior Software Engineer Golang specialist?

To become a Senior Software Engineer Golang specialist, you need to have a strong understanding of the Golang programming language. You can gain this knowledge by taking online courses, attending training programs or boot camps, or working on personal projects. You should also have experience in software development and an understanding of software design principles.

Average salary

According to Glassdoor, the average salary for a Senior Software Engineer Golang is $124,000 per year in the United States. However, this can vary depending on factors such as location, experience, and company size.

Roles and types

Senior Software Engineer Golang is a role that can be found in a variety of industries, including technology, finance, healthcare, and e-commerce. The position can also be classified based on the type of software being developed, such as web applications, mobile applications, or software for embedded systems.

Locations with the most popular jobs in USA

The most popular locations for Senior Software Engineer Golang jobs in the United States are San Francisco, New York, Seattle, Austin, and Boston. These cities have a strong technology industry and offer a high demand for skilled software engineers.

What are the typical tools?

As a Senior Software Engineer Golang, you will use a variety of tools to develop and maintain software programs. Some of the typical tools include Integrated Development Environments (IDEs) such as Visual Studio Code, GoLand, and Sublime Text. You may also use tools such as Git for version control, Docker for containerization, and PostgreSQL for databases.

In conclusion

Becoming a Senior Software Engineer Golang specialist requires a strong understanding of the Golang programming language, software development, and software design principles. The role offers a great salary and can be found in a variety of industries. If you are interested in this field, consider taking online courses or attending training programs to gain the necessary skills and knowledge.